Subject: [PATCH 1/5] tests/docker: Add sqlite3 module to openSUSE Leap container

From: Fabiano Rosas <farosas@suse.de>

Avocado needs sqlite3:

  Failed to load plugin from module "avocado.plugins.journal":
  ImportError("Module 'sqlite3' is not installed.
  Use: sudo zypper install python311 to install it")

>From 'zypper info python311':
  "This package supplies rich command line features provided by
  readline, and sqlite3 support for the interpreter core, thus forming
  a so called "extended" runtime."

Include the appropriate package in the lcitool mappings which will
guarantee the dockerfile gets properly updated when lcitool is
run. Also include the updated dockerfile.

---
 tests/docker/dockerfiles/opensuse-leap.docker | 1 +
 tests/lcitool/mappings.yml                    | 4 ++++
 tests/lcitool/projects/qemu.yml               | 1 +
 3 files changed, 6 insertions(+)

diff --git a/tests/docker/dockerfiles/opensuse-leap.docker b/tests/docker/dockerfiles/opensuse-leap.docker
index dc0e36ce488..cf753383a45 100644
--- a/tests/docker/dockerfiles/opensuse-leap.docker
+++ b/tests/docker/dockerfiles/opensuse-leap.docker
@@ -90,6 +90,7 @@ RUN zypper update -y && \
            pcre-devel-static \
            pipewire-devel \
            pkgconfig \
+           python311 \
            python311-base \
            python311-pip \
            python311-setuptools \
diff --git a/tests/lcitool/mappings.yml b/tests/lcitool/mappings.yml
index 0b908882f1d..407c03301bf 100644
--- a/tests/lcitool/mappings.yml
+++ b/tests/lcitool/mappings.yml
@@ -59,6 +59,10 @@ mappings:
     CentOSStream8:
     OpenSUSELeap15:
 
+  python3-sqlite3:
+    CentOSStream8: python38
+    OpenSUSELeap15: python311
+
   python3-tomli:
     # test using tomllib
     apk:
diff --git a/tests/lcitool/projects/qemu.yml b/tests/lcitool/projects/qemu.yml
index 82092c9f175..149b15de57b 100644
--- a/tests/lcitool/projects/qemu.yml
+++ b/tests/lcitool/projects/qemu.yml
@@ -97,6 +97,7 @@ packages:
  - python3-pip
  - python3-sphinx
  - python3-sphinx-rtd-theme
+ - python3-sqlite3
  - python3-tomli
  - python3-venv
  - rpm2cpio
